A Boxy Library Pavilion with Fairy Tale Charm

Once upon a time, architecture firm Atelier Kastelic Buffey designed a lending library to transform Newmarket’s central square into a community hub – and everyone lived happily ever after.

Dubbed the Story Pod, the slatted black pavilion cracks open during the day, revealing a plywood-panelled interior with built-in shelves and seating.Visitors are free to pick from the page-turners, and are encouraged to donate old favourites for future bookworms.
